    PURPOSE:  Under the direction of the Sr. Director of IT (or his/her delegate), and in collaboration with The Ohio State University Wexner Medical Center (OSUWMC), will provide consultation in the planning, design, development, and delivery of training for EPIC or other electronic medical record and systems; identify mechanisms to optimize system utilization and processes; assists in the review of workflows and processes; and provide training to staff and physicians.

    REQUIREMENTS:  Bachelor of Science in a clinical field, information systems or related field, or equivalent education and experience.  A minimum of 1-2 years of experience with an electronic medical record or system.  Possess strong communication skills to respond to common and complex inquiries.  Ability to demonstrate initiative and completion of projects, self-motivation and ability to work independently while being a team player. Extensive knowledge of adult learning principles, and demonstrated experience using these principles when building training plans and materials.  Critical thinking to be able to work at the highest technical level of most phases of application education while being able to consider current and future state implications.

    PREFERENCES: Epic

    D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

    • Assesses clinical training needs of the organization, department and end user.  Assists in the analysis and evaluation of existing or proposed clinical systems, workflows and processes; works collaboratively to define future state for clinical workflows.
    • Delivers training to various audiences (new hires, refresher training, skill enhancement and system update training).  Responsible for managing moderately, complex clinical applications training issues and problems; provides technical support in response to user issues and questions pertaining to training, functionality, operations, input/output, reporting and general operating procedures.
    • Implements training/communications; coordinates system change communications; keeps end users up to date on system changes or updates throughout a project or upgrade.
    • Assists in the development of change management strategies and training needs.
    • Provides and recommends creative solutions to processes and procedures for enhancements, additions, or modifications to improve clinical systems.  Advises the build teams on any such system enhancements or modifications.
    • Participates in a variety of training and optimization projects.
    • Develops and maintains networks of super users within specialty areas; utilizes these groups to assure end user familiarity with system changes and enhancements.
    • Serves as a liaison between training and IT to coordinate needs assessments, impact analyses, resource utilization, system requirements and integration methodologies.
